Among the many photos with the all new 2012 3 Series, the Germans from BMW have also added a few pics with the M Package kit for the new saloon.
The kit contains sportier looking bits of exterior and interior trim along with a few mechanical tweaks such as a stiffer suspension with new anti roll bars and a lowered center of gravity (- 10 mm).
Visually the 2012 BMW 3 Series M Package makes the Bavarian sedan look more attractive through elements like 18 inch alloy wheels, sportier looking bumpers, chromed exhaust pipes and an unique, high-gloss body colour.
For the interior BMW offers sports seats that use a combination of Alcantara and fabric, the M Shortshifter for the manual transmission equipped models, an awesome looking M Sport steering wheel and various other unique accents.
Among options for the 2012 BMW 3 Series M Package customers will find 19 inch alloys, better brakes and the Adaptive M Sport suspension.
